怎么将excel表格的内容变成一个文件名
发布网友
发布时间:2024-08-19 22:48
我来回答
共1个回答
热心网友
时间:2024-08-23 15:09
将Excel的内容转化为文件名,可以使用CELL函数和MID函数结合的方法来实现。
具体步骤如下:
在需要生成文件名的单元格中输入公式“=CELL("filename")”。
如果只需要文件名,可以在另一个单元格中使用MID函数来提取文件名,公式为“=MID(A1,FIND("[",A1)+1,FIND("]",A1)-FIND("[",A1)-1)”,其中A1为包含文件名的单元格。
如果不需要后缀名,可以将公式修改为“=MID(A1,FIND("[",A1)+1,FIND(".xlsx]",A1)-FIND("[",A1)-1)”。
这样就可以将Excel表格中的内容转化为文件名了。
生成的文件名将包含文件路径和sheet名,如果需要去掉这些部分,可以使用文本处理函数进行进一步的处理。
要将Excel的内容转化为文件名,可以使用Excel的宏编程功能来实现。首先打开一个新的Excel工作簿,然后按下Alt+F11进入VBA编辑器界面。
在此界面内,可以创建一个新的宏,在其中编写代码,在保存工作簿时将其内容转化为文件名。
在编写代码时,需要使用Excel的内置函数,如CONCATENATE和LEFT等来将不同的单元格内容组合起来,从而生成文件名。
最后,可以将该宏设置为工作簿的保存事件,以确保每次保存时都会自动将内容转化为文件名并保存到指定位置。